This Cream of Vegetable Soup brings together a medley of fresh vegetables in a creamy coconut milk base, with an added kick from a homemade green chili paste. The soup is rich in flavor, with the creamy coconut milk and vegetable broth providing a silky texture, while the green chili paste adds depth and spice. The combination of potatoes, carrots, and bok choy not only enhances the flavor but also provides a comforting, hearty texture. This soup is perfect for a cozy meal on a chilly day and pairs beautifully with rice or udon for a complete dish.
Ingredients:
For the Green Chili Paste:
½ bunch of cilantro
5 garlic cloves
2 scallions
2 Thai green chilies
½-inch piece of ginger, peeled and sliced
1 lemongrass stalk
1 tsp black peppercorns, ground
½ tsp coriander seeds, ground
½ tsp cumin seeds, ground
2 tsp salt
1 tsp sugar
Zest and juice of 2 limes
2 tsp canola oil
For the Soup:
1 tbsp canola oil
½ onion, sliced
½ red onion, sliced
½ lb small potato medley
3 carrots, peeled and cut into bite-sized pieces
2 cups vegetable broth
4 baby bok choy, quartered
30 oz coconut milk
Chives, diced (for garnish)
Directions:
Prepare the Green Chili Paste:
In a food processor, combine all the ingredients for the green chili paste. Pulse until it resembles a thick salsa. Store in the refrigerator until ready to use. The paste should last up to a week.
Cook the Soup:
Heat a pot over medium-high heat and add 1 tbsp of canola oil. Add the onions and sauté until softened, about 5 minutes.
Add the potatoes and carrots, tossing them together with the onions, and cook for an additional 5 minutes to slightly heat the vegetables.
Pour in the vegetable broth, b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to simmer. Cover the pot slightly ajar and simmer for 20 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ender.
Add the prepared green chili paste and coconut milk to the pot, stirring well to combine.
Add the bok choy and simmer for an additional 5 minutes or until the bok choy is softened.
Serve the soup hot in bowls, garnished with diced chives. Optionally, serve with cooked rice or udon for a more filling meal.
Nutritional Value (per serving):
Calories: 314 kcal
Carbohydrates: 28g
Protein: 5g
Fat: 22g
Saturated Fat: 18g
Cholesterol: 0mg
Sodium: 878mg
Potassium: 800mg
Fiber: 4g
Sugar: 6g
Vitamin A: 151%
Vitamin C: 24%
Calcium: 5%
Iron: 9%
